You can find success by blending oils that have the same constituents and properties. You can also blend oils by using the Three-Note Scale and odor intensity guide.
 
Odor Intensity Guide:
This guide is written on a 1 t 10 scale
  • 1 to 4 indentifies the lightest aromas which are delicate and more fleeting
  • 4 to 7 identifies aromas with moderate intensity  and can last for hours
  • 7 to 10 identifies aromas that are strongest and can last for days.
1. Bass Notes are 5 to 20% of the blend. They are 7 to 10 on the odor intensity guide. They are placed in the blending bottle first. They act as the grounding and foundation of the blend. The aroma of these oils lasts for days., (For example Bergamot, Lemon, Lemongrass)
2. Middle Notes are 50 to 80% of the blend. They are 4 to 7 on the odor intensity guide. They are placed int he blending bottle second. they are the heart of the blend, weaving together the bass and top notes, enhancing the properties of the other oils. Their fragrance can last for hours. (such as Coriander, Ginger,wild Orange)
3. Top Notes are 5 to 20% of the blend. They are 1 to 4 on the odor intensity guide. They are placed in the blending bottle third. Their fragrance effect the olfactory sense first. They are more delicate and are often sweet, fruity, spicy or earthy. (Such as grapefruit, Sandalwood)
 
When you are layering it would be because you are using all Middle Notes, such as Eucalyptus and Melaleuca.
